g03车圆球怎么编程

时间:2025-01-26 23:42:00 网络游戏

在数控编程中,车圆球通常使用G02(顺时针圆弧插补)或G03(逆时针圆弧插补)指令。以下是编程的一般步骤和示例:

设定刀具起始点和切入方式

将刀具移动到圆弧的起点。

选择合适的切入方式(例如,直接切入、斜切入等)。

设定切削参数

进给速度(F)。

主轴转速(S)。

进给深度(AP或深度)。

编写圆弧插补指令

使用G02或G03指令编写圆弧的插补指令。

指定圆心坐标(X0, Y0)。

半径(R)。

旋转方向(顺时针或逆时针)。

增量坐标(I, J)或绝对坐标(X, Z)。

编写结束指令

在车圆球完成后,编写相应的结束指令,如停止主轴转动、返回初始位置等。

示例代码

```plaintext

N10 G90 G17 G20 ; 绝对坐标模式,选择XY平面,英寸单位

N20 G94 F100 ; 进给率以每分钟为单位

N30 T1 M06 ; 选择刀具1并自动换刀

N40 S1000 M03; 主轴转速为1000转/分钟,正转

N50 G00 X0. Y0. Z0. ; 快速移动到起始点(X0, Y0, Z0)

N60 G43 H01 Z0.1; 刀具长度补偿,并设置Z轴偏移值为0.1

N70 G01 X1. Y0.; 直线插补移动到指定位置(X1, Y0)

N80 G03 X0. Y0. I-1. J0. ; 圆弧插补,以起始点(0, 0)为圆心,逆时针方向绘制半径为1的圆弧

N90 G01 X0. Y0.; 直线插补移动回起始点(0, 0)

N100 G40 ; 刀具半径补偿取消

N110 G00 Z0.1 ; 快速移动到Z轴偏移0.1的位置

N120 M30 ; 程序结束

```

解释

G90:绝对坐标模式。

G17:选择XY平面。

G20:英寸单位。

G94:进给率以每分钟为单位。

T1:选择刀具1。

M06:自动换刀。

S1000:主轴转速为1000转/分钟。

G00:快速移动到指定坐标。

G43:刀具长度补偿。

G01:直线插补。

G03:逆时针圆弧插补,指定圆心坐标(0, 0),半径为1,增量坐标I-1, J0。

G40:取消刀具半径补偿。

M30:程序结束。

请根据具体的机床型号和编程环境调整上述代码。如果使用CAD/CAM软件,还可以将球形的三维模型转换为G代码,以简化编程过程。